An installation starts with a load check so the new system matches the home’s cooling needs. The technician reviews the old equipment, duct condition, electrical setup, and drain path before selecting the replacement plan. In Miami, that matters because attic heat, humidity, and salt air can affect how the system performs after setup. On install day, the old equipment comes out, the new system is set in place, lines and controls are connected, and the unit is tested for cooling, airflow, and drainage.

After installation, the system should cool more evenly and cycle with less strain if the sizing and setup match the home. The life of the new system depends on maintenance, humidity control, and how much the unit runs through Miami’s long cooling season. To protect the investment, schedule maintenance and watch for changes in airflow, noise, or drainage after the first few weeks.

Manual J Sizing

Heat load calculated to spec before any unit is selected. Proper sizing prevents short-cycling, humidity problems, and early system failure.

The cost of AC installation in Miami depends on the size of the home, the type of system selected, the duct condition, and any electrical or drain work needed. A replacement can also cost more if the old equipment is hard to remove or if the new setup needs extra changes to fit the house. Miami heat, humidity, and attic placement can affect the install plan too. The best quote comes after a full look at the home and the existing system.
You should expect a site visit first, then a written quote that shows what the installation includes. The technician should review the home, the current cooling setup, and any needed changes before giving pricing. In Miami, that review matters because attic heat, duct layout, and humidity can affect the final install. Ask what parts, labor, and cleanup are included so you know what the quote covers.

Repair can make sense when the problem is small and the rest of the system is still in good shape. Replacement may be the better choice when the AC has repeated breakdowns, poor cooling, or major wear from long use in Miami heat. If repairs keep coming back, the new installation can be the more practical choice. A technician can compare the cost of more fixes with the condition of the current system.
AC installation should be handled by a pro because it involves electrical work, refrigerant handling, drainage, and airflow setup. A mistake can leave the system undercharged, unsafe, or badly matched to the home. In Miami, attic heat and humidity make a poor install show problems even faster. A trained technician can size the system, install it correctly, and test it before use.
If the same problem shows up after installation, the cause may be outside the new unit itself. Duct leaks, drain issues, thermostat problems, or airflow restrictions can still affect the system. In Miami, humidity can reveal setup issues quickly, so follow-up checks matter if the symptoms come back. A technician can inspect the full cooling path and correct what is still causing trouble.

Miami humidity matters because the system has to cool the home and help remove moisture at the same time. If the new AC is not matched to the home, it may cool too fast or too slowly and leave rooms feeling damp. That is why sizing and setup matter so much here. A well planned installation helps the system handle both heat and humidity more effectively.
After installation, change filters on time, keep vents open, and watch for any water near the unit or weak airflow. In Miami, that follow-up matters because humidity and attic heat can stress a new system early if something is off. It also helps to schedule maintenance before peak cooling season. Those steps help the system stay in better shape for longer.
How long a new AC lasts depends on the system type, how well it was installed, and how much maintenance it gets. Miami’s long cooling season, humidity, and salt air can shorten the life of parts if upkeep gets skipped. Regular care can help the system run better for more years before major work is needed. The right next step is to monitor the system and keep a service schedule.
Yes, attic ducts and attic heat can affect how a new AC performs in Miami. The technician should check insulation, duct condition, and airflow because those parts can shape comfort as much as the unit itself. If the ducts leak or the airflow is weak, the new system may not cool evenly. A careful installation helps the home get the full benefit of the replacement.
